Nigerian Defence Minister Addresses Insecurity, Calls for Public Cooperation

Nigerian Defence Minister Addresses Insecurity, Calls for Public Cooperation

Nigerian Defence Minister Gen. Christoph Musa addressed the prevalence of insecurity in Nigeria, attributing it to individuals and communities shielding bandits, terrorists, and criminals.

He stressed the importance of public cooperation in intelligence sharing to combat these threats effectively. Emir Doma Kingdom's Alhaji Ahmadu Onawu emphasized the need for Nigeria to leverage its abundant human capital and natural resources for sustainable development, urging all Nigerians to contribute to building a prosperous and self-reliant nation.

Musa highlighted the gradual improvement in the country's security situation due to sustained military operations, enhanced intelligence gathering, and growing public support. He urged Nigerians to report criminal activities promptly and assured a decisive response from security agencies.

The call for unity, resource deployment, and active participation in nation-building resonated in both leaders' messages.
